DG419LEUA+T Frequently Asked Questions (FAQs)

  • A good PCB layout for the DG419LEUA+T involves keeping the analog and digital grounds separate, using a solid ground plane, and minimizing trace lengths and widths to reduce noise and parasitic inductance. It's also recommended to place the device near the analog signal sources and keep the digital signals away from the analog signals.
  • To ensure reliability and stability in high-temperature environments, it's essential to follow proper thermal management practices, such as providing adequate heat sinking, using a thermally conductive material for the PCB, and keeping the device within its recommended operating temperature range. Additionally, consider using a thermal interface material between the device and the heat sink.
  • The DG419LEUA+T can be susceptible to EMI and RFI due to its high-frequency operation. To mitigate these issues, use proper shielding, such as a metal enclosure or a shielded cable, and follow good PCB layout practices, such as keeping sensitive analog signals away from digital signals and using a solid ground plane. Additionally, consider using EMI filters or ferrite beads on the input and output lines.
  • To troubleshoot common issues with the DG419LEUA+T, start by checking the power supply voltage, ensuring it's within the recommended range. Verify that the input signals are within the specified range and that the device is properly configured. Use an oscilloscope to check the output voltage and verify that it's within the expected range. If issues persist, consult the datasheet and application notes for guidance or contact Analog Devices' technical support.
  • When using the DG419LEUA+T in a system with multiple power domains, it's essential to ensure proper power sequencing to prevent damage to the device or system malfunction. Follow the recommended power-up and power-down sequences, and consider using power sequencing controllers or supervisors to manage the power domains. Additionally, ensure that the device is powered up and down slowly to prevent voltage spikes or transients.

About Analog Devices

Analog Devices Inc. is a global leader in the design and manufacturing of analog, mixed-signal, and digital signal processing integrated circuits and software solutions for the industrial, automotive, healthcare, communications industries. Analog Devices serves a diverse range of markets including industrial, automotive, healthcare, energy, aerospace, defense, and consumer electronics industries. Analog Devices’ product portfolio includes a wide range of ICs, modules, and subsystems.
